## Authentication

Graphloom, the dependency graph visualizer, reads build metadata from the internal Lattice registry. Every request must carry a service key in the Graphloom-Auth header; anonymous reads were disabled last quarter. Keys are scoped read-only and rotate each release cycle, so verify the current cycle before cutting a build. The active release-cycle key appears below.

API key for yahig-tadup: kto7_ubizbYm

**Ticket DEDUP-221: Quietowl deduplicator can't hold a DB connection**

Hey — welcome aboard! First task: Quietowl (our alert deduplicator) keeps losing its connection to the fingerprint store mid-shift, so duplicate pages slip through and wake people up twice. Logs show resets about every ten minutes, probably a keepalive mismatch. Can you spin it up locally and try to reproduce? You'll need read access to the staging fingerprint database, which you can reach with the connection string below.

primary connection of yagep-kahip = redis://giliel_svc:zYiKsLL2PLpfPL@db-348f.xolmarsys.corp:5432/fenwyn

**Mgmt Meeting Minutes — Retiring the Brightline Range**

Quick recap for sales leads at Fenholt Supplies: we agreed to retire the Brightline fixture range by year-end. Remaining stock moves to clearance pricing next month, and accounts on standing orders get migrated to the Lumetta range. Trade-in incentives were approved in principle. The confidential note on next steps sits just below.

board note of bajof-bajeg: The pricing group signed off on a budget of $13.4 million for Project Sildor. The renewal with Lamixek Holdings closes at $48.9 million a year, 49 percent above the last contract.